As a Planner, you’ll take ownership of the project plan, drive the project team to deliver to the plan and challenge any delay and deviation. Leading, coaching and guiding a small team of more junior Planners, you’ll be viewed as an approachable Planning expert who is keen to pass on experience and knowledge to develop others and drive outperformance amongst the team.

Key responsibilities:

  • Collaboratively develop and maintain robust detailed project plans for the Delivery Team in accordance with Contract requirements ensuring methodology is consistently followed.
  • Ensure project plans capture the full project scope and resources are considered and loaded as required.
  • Pro-actively identify opportunities and risks in the plan and monitor the critical path and key milestones, advising the delivery team on any potential changes.
  • Design and implement effective and value-added communication plans ensuring relevant teams and individuals are clear and buy into the strategy and approach.
  • Ensure planning standards are maintained and published processes are adhered to.
  • Appreciate and uphold the Health & Safety standards in all planning processes.
  • Enable Project Management to control the progress of contracts by identifying and producing integrated programmes of work (design, procurement, construction, commissioning and handover), monitoring performance against plans and identifying problem areas and potential early warnings.
  • Minimise company risk by identifying the critical path for contracts.
  • Help the project team minimise company risk by identifying the critical path for contracts.
  • Enable resource planning and levelling by appropriate resource analysis of contracts.
  • Detailed knowledge of the NEC contract and programme requirements.
  • Lead the planning section at contract/progress review meetings.
  • Production of required project reports including identification of project risks and opportunities.
  • Resource load plans in collaboration with the lead disciplines to provide programme wide visibility of resource demand.
  • Support in producing tender programmes, with assistance from delivery managers & pre-construction team.

Essential

  • Minimum of 3 years’ experience as a Project Planner within construction, engineering, or infrastructure environments.
  • Degree Qualification in Construction Management or similar.
  • Strong knowledge of project planning tools and techniques (e.g. Primavera P6, MS Project, or equivalent).
  • Demonstrable experience working with NEC contracts and associated programme requirements.
  • Highly self-motivated with the ability to work independently and manage competing priorities.
  • Confident communicator with the ability to challenge construction teams constructively and professionally.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with attention to detail.
  • Full UK driving licence.

Desirable

  • Experience working on multi-disciplinary or complex projects.
  • Knowledge of risk management, change control, and earned value principles.
  • Ability to influence stakeholders at all levels of the organisation.
  • Experience contributing to tender planning and pre-construction activities.
